'use strict';
var collection = require('../../type/collection');
function factory (type, config, load, typed) {
/**
* Get the imaginary part of a complex number.
* For a complex number `a + bi`, the function returns `b`.
*
* For matrices, the function is evaluated element wise.
*
* Syntax:
*
* math.im(x)
*
* Examples:
*
* var a = math.complex(2, 3);
* math.re(a); // returns Number 2
* math.im(a); // returns Number 3
*
* math.re(math.complex('-5.2i')); // returns Number -5.2
* math.re(math.complex(2.4)); // returns Number 0
*
* See also:
*
* re, conj, abs, arg
*
* @param {Number | BigNumber | Complex | Array | Matrix | Boolean | null} x
* A complex number or array with complex numbers
* @return {Number | BigNumber | Array | Matrix} The imaginary part of x
*/
var im = typed('im', {
'number': function (x) {
return 0;
},
'BigNumber': function (x) {
return new x.constructor(0);
},
'Complex': function (x) {
return x.im;
},
'Array | Matrix': function (x) {
return collection.deepMap(x, im);
}
});
return im;
}
exports.name = 'im';
exports.factory = factory;
